Sun-Filled Main Floor Bungalow in Prime Location - Steps to TTC & Minutes to Hwy 401! Bright and spacious main floor of a beautifully maintained wide-style bungalow, offering functional layout and generous room sizes throughout. Features a large eat-in kitchen with upgraded cabinetry and granite countertops. Sun-filled living and dining areas with wide hallways create an inviting atmosphere. Enjoy exclusive use of private washer & dryer (no sharing), plus a good-sized fenced backyard with patio and garden shed-perfect for relaxing or entertaining. Includes two garage parking and one driveway parking. Additional highlights include cozy sunroom with skylights and fireplace (heated for year-round use), and newer high-efficiency gas furnace (2023) and hot water tank (2024). Quiet, south-facing home in a fantastic family-friendly neighborhood-steps to parks, TTC, schools, shopping, and restaurants, with quick highway access. Ideal for professionals or small families seeking comfort, convenience, and quality living. Simply move in and enjoy! (Virtual Staging, no furniture included)

Who lives here?

Tam O'Shanter Sullivan, Toronto is an east Toronto neighbourhood notable for its renters and science professionals.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from China, the Philippines and India, and Cantonese and Mandarin spe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 50 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 74.
